El Monopolio de la Memoria
Directed by Pablo Martínez-Zárate
This film takes a dive into a photographic archive that portrays the 1968 student movement in Mexico. By reviewing over 1300 photographs of students, soldiers and citizens, and the development of a movement inside the Mexican capital, marked by the massive uprisings and the government's repression, the film questions the relationship between memory, power and representation.
